Freshen up with Rina's signature care

THERE'S a time for work and there's a time to treat the body to a massage that would exfoliate, stimulate and boost relaxation.

At Rina Balinese Resort in Lot 2515, Lorong 6, Kampung Seelong Jaya, Senai, one will be able to invigorate the body and pep up the spirits.

It is unbelievable that such a place exists near bustling Johor Baru.
Although the drive to the resort may be a bit bumpy, it is worth the trip.

The resort, which is managed by Rina Nature Spa and Recreation Sdn Bhd, has experienced masseurs to pamper one with authentic Javanese massages for RM98 an hour.

The company's president Robert Lew said more masseurs will be brought in if there is an influx of guests.

"Some regulars request for a three-hour massage. We also have seminar participants who come in for massages as it is part of their programme," said Lew.

The masseur uses the thumb to apply pressure at the body's energy meridians to stimulate the lymphatic system and to relief taut muscles.

This also helps to improve blood circulation.

The age-old massage therapy is just one of the many services available. Rina is popular for its organic facial treatments, volcanic foot spa, belly candling, therapeutic sand spa, herbal body scrub, herbal jacuzzi and firewood herbal steam baths.

Neatly tucked away across the 1.2ha resort is a herbal garden. The establishment also draws water from its own well which is why the brewed drinks at the resort taste better.

Not-to-be-missed is the ginger tea which is served before and after a massage.
